Protesters attack DRC treatment center as the WHO warns violence is threatening Ebola efforts

The World Health Organization warned Friday that violence is impeding efforts to contain a deadly Ebola outbreak in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C), after protesters demanding the return of a victim’s body set fire to a treatment center.
